Title: Northern Hardwood Research Institute is established in Edmundston, NB
Post by: SwampDonkey on May 13, 2012, 06:35:30 AM
"We are proud to be supporting the creation of the Hardwood Research Institute which will generate research and teaching jobs here in New Brunswick while also enhancing the competitiveness of Canada's forestry industry," Harper said in a statement.

"It"s applicable research so when we look at silviculture and what we can do to improve the quality of hardwood stands, when we look at things like developing better processes, when we look at developing and diversifying markets... The announcements today really helped the Hardwood sector in our province move forward," Alward said.

The total project will cost $4.2 million."
